How to create a link to a document in Joomla? This comprehensive guide dives deep into the various methods, from simple embedding to advanced techniques, ensuring your documents are seamlessly integrated into your Joomla website, regardless of their location or type. We’ll cover everything from basic linking to sophisticated document management, making your site user-friendly and professional.
From embedding documents directly within articles to linking to files hosted elsewhere, this guide provides practical steps and considerations. Understanding the different methods, optimal formats, and potential pitfalls is key to successful document integration. We’ll also explore Joomla extensions and plugins to streamline your workflow, providing a thorough approach to document management.
Methods for Embedding Documents
Integrating documents into Joomla articles is crucial for providing comprehensive information. This process enhances user experience and ensures easy access to supporting materials. Effective document integration improves website functionality and user engagement.A well-structured approach to embedding documents in Joomla articles allows readers to access relevant information without navigating away from the main content. This seamless integration streamlines the user journey, improving the overall user experience.
Choosing the right method depends on the type of document, its location, and the desired user experience.
Document Embedding Methods
Different methods allow embedding documents directly into a Joomla article, each with advantages and disadvantages. Understanding these distinctions is essential for achieving optimal results.
- Direct Embedding via Joomla’s built-in features: Joomla offers built-in functionality for embedding certain file types directly within articles. This method is straightforward, requiring minimal setup. However, file size limitations and compatibility restrictions may apply. For instance, embedding large PDFs might slow down page load times, while embedding unsupported formats won’t be possible at all.
- Using the Joomla’s built-in file manager: This method leverages Joomla’s internal file management system. It offers control over file storage and retrieval. Users can create links to files stored on the server, allowing for easy access. This method is suitable for documents stored within the Joomla installation. It ensures that files are centrally managed and readily available.
- Linking to External Documents: Using hyperlinks to external documents can be a convenient option. This is beneficial for linking to resources hosted on other websites. However, users might leave the current page to access the linked document. This method is suitable for sharing documents hosted on external servers, promoting cross-website information sharing.
Linking to Documents
Proper linking is crucial for seamless navigation. Different linking methods offer various advantages and drawbacks, influencing user experience.
- Using Relative Paths: Linking to documents stored within the same folder structure as the Joomla article uses relative paths. This method simplifies linking to documents within the website’s file structure. However, moving files could break the link. Relative paths are often preferred for linking to internal documents, streamlining navigation.
- Using Absolute Paths: Linking using absolute paths refers to the full URL of the document. This method is suitable for linking to external resources. It ensures the link works consistently, regardless of website structure. Absolute paths are useful for linking to external documents, providing a consistent link.
- Using Internal Links: Using Joomla’s internal linking mechanisms allows for creating a clear structure. This simplifies navigation for users, promoting accessibility. Internal links ensure that documents are easily accessible within the website, enhancing user experience.
Document Location Considerations
Linking to documents stored in different locations requires careful consideration of the approach. Understanding file locations and their implications for linking is essential.
Understanding how to create links in Joomla is crucial for website navigation. This translates directly to successful content strategy. For instance, if you want to link to detailed instructions on how to grow St Augustine grass plugs, ensure the link points to a robust resource like how to grow st augustine grass plugs. Properly implemented links enhance user experience and search engine optimization, making your Joomla site a valuable resource.
You can then focus on creating high-quality, SEO-friendly content.
- Internal Documents: Linking to documents stored on the same server as the Joomla site is straightforward. Use relative paths for internal links to maintain consistency when documents are moved. This ensures efficient navigation and avoids external dependencies.
- External Documents: Linking to external documents requires using absolute paths to ensure the link remains valid. This is suitable for linking to documents hosted on other websites. This method supports cross-website information sharing, promoting broader reach.
Cross-Version Compatibility
Ensuring document links work consistently across different Joomla versions is vital for long-term usability. Understanding the impact of version upgrades is essential.
- File Path Consistency: Maintain consistent file paths to avoid broken links after Joomla updates. This approach ensures long-term usability and avoids disruptions to website navigation. Regular updates are necessary to prevent errors.
- Testing and Verification: Regularly test links to verify that they work as expected across different Joomla versions. This method ensures seamless navigation and avoids frustrating user experiences. Comprehensive testing is key to successful link management.
Method Comparison, How to create a link to a document in joomla
A table summarizing the key aspects of the different embedding methods helps in making informed decisions. Choosing the best method depends on factors like ease of use, security, and performance.
Method | Ease of Use | Security | Performance |
---|---|---|---|
Direct Embedding | High | Medium | Medium |
File Manager Link | Medium | High | High |
External Link | High | Low | High |
Joomla Extensions and Plugins: How To Create A Link To A Document In Joomla

Optimizing document management within a Joomla website can significantly boost user experience and site performance. Utilizing extensions and plugins tailored for document linking and organization can streamline the process, making it easier for users to find and access the necessary information. These tools can also improve by allowing for better organization and structuring of content. Choosing the right extensions ensures a seamless user journey and improved site navigation.
Available Joomla Extensions
Various Joomla extensions cater to document management needs. These extensions often provide features like document libraries, advanced search functionalities, and options for different document formats. Careful consideration of available options is crucial for selecting the most appropriate extension for a specific website’s needs.
Understanding Joomla’s document linking is crucial for SEO. You’ll need to use HTML anchor tags to create a link to your document, ensuring proper formatting and structure. While this might seem straightforward, a common issue arises when the document you’re linking to is located on a different page, requiring careful consideration of the URL. This is similar to how addressing a medical issue like a crossbite, where proper diagnosis and treatment require a multifaceted approach.
How to fix a crossbite is a good example of this complex process, much like the meticulous coding involved in creating robust Joomla links. This detailed approach will ensure your links are both functional and SEO-friendly.
Integrating Joomla Document Management Plugins
Integration of document management plugins typically involves a straightforward process. Download the chosen extension from the Joomla Extension Directory. Follow the installation instructions, which usually include steps like uploading the plugin files and activating it within the Joomla admin panel. The specifics may vary depending on the chosen extension.
Features of Document Management Plugins
These plugins often include features like centralized document storage, user permissions control, and robust search capabilities. They enable administrators to manage document access effectively. Specific features can include version control for documents, allowing administrators to track changes over time. Metadata tagging enhances searchability and organization, allowing users to find relevant documents quickly. These features can help optimize a website’s performance by improving user experience and site navigation.
Document Library Extension Template
A basic template for a document library extension could include a hierarchical structure for organizing documents. This allows for categories and subcategories, making it easy to manage a large volume of files. A user-friendly interface should prioritize ease of navigation and access to documents. Clear labeling and sorting features will enhance user efficiency. The template should support different file formats and sizes to accommodate various document types.
Configuring the Extension for Different Formats
Configuration for different document formats often involves setting up appropriate file handling. The extension should be configured to support various file types. This might include common formats like .pdf, .doc, .docx, and .txt. In some cases, the extension may allow for specific configuration options for each supported format. This ensures compatibility with the documents on the website.
Creating a link to a document within Joomla involves using specific HTML tags, much like how you’d approach fixing a gas tank with a hole—a task requiring precise steps. For example, using anchor tags, you’ll need to know the document’s file path. This is crucial for creating a functional link. Properly addressing the document’s file path within the tag ensures easy navigation for users, mirroring the careful repair needed for a gas tank with a hole, as detailed in this helpful guide: how to fix a gas tank with a hole.
Ultimately, a correctly implemented link in Joomla is key to user experience.
Detailed configuration instructions are usually available within the extension’s documentation.
Advanced Techniques and Considerations
Optimizing Joomla document linking goes beyond basic embed codes. Dynamic linking, handling potential document changes, and providing user-friendly previews are crucial for a seamless user experience and search engine optimization. This section delves into advanced strategies for creating robust and adaptable document linking systems within your Joomla site.Effective document management in Joomla hinges on adaptability. A dynamic system that anticipates changes in document status and user roles is essential for maintaining site integrity and user access.
Creating a link to a document within Joomla involves using the appropriate HTML tags. Understanding the nuances of different document types, and how long it takes to master Excel skills like formulas and functions, is helpful. For instance, learning to use nested functions or pivot tables in Excel will likely take significant time and effort, as detailed in this helpful guide how long does it take to learn excel.
Ultimately, meticulous attention to the proper HTML syntax is key to ensuring your document links work seamlessly within your Joomla site.
This section explores techniques to achieve precisely that.
Dynamic Linking Based on User Roles and Permissions
User-specific access to documents is vital for security and compliance. Implementing dynamic links based on user roles and permissions ensures that only authorized users can access specific documents. This is achieved by integrating Joomla’s user role management system with your document linking mechanism. A well-structured approach involves using Joomla’s built-in access control mechanisms to determine the appropriate document access levels for different user groups.
This strategy safeguards sensitive information and maintains a compliant digital environment.
Linking to Documents within a Library
A well-organized document library is crucial for easy navigation. Employing a hierarchical structure for your documents facilitates efficient organization and allows users to easily locate the required files. Clear categorization and sub-categories enable users to find the precise document they need within the larger document library, improving user experience and satisfaction.
Handling Document Removal and Updates
Document management systems must be resilient to changes. A robust system should address the potential for linked documents to be removed or updated. Implementing a mechanism that either redirects users to an appropriate alternative or displays a user-friendly message indicating the document’s unavailability is critical for maintaining a positive user experience. In the event of a document update, a system to update the link automatically or inform the user about the change is necessary.
Ensuring Link Functionality with Location Changes
Document links should remain functional even if the underlying document’s location changes. A robust solution involves using Joomla’s built-in document management features or custom plugins to track and update document paths. Implementing such a system prevents broken links, ensuring the user’s ability to locate the intended resource.
Displaying Document Previews
Previewing documents within a Joomla article enhances user engagement. This functionality allows users to assess the content before navigating to the full document. This strategy can be implemented by embedding a document viewer or utilizing Joomla’s built-in image gallery capabilities to display representative portions of the document. Such features increase user engagement and comprehension, particularly when dealing with lengthy documents.
End of Discussion

In conclusion, linking documents effectively within your Joomla site is crucial for user experience and site organization. This guide provided a comprehensive overview of the different methods, from simple linking to advanced techniques using Joomla extensions. By understanding the best practices and considering various factors like file paths and document types, you can ensure your documents are accessible, functional, and enhance your Joomla website’s overall appeal.
The FAQs further solidify this knowledge, addressing potential challenges.
Q&A
How do I link to a document stored on an external website?
Use a standard hyperlink, incorporating the correct URL of the external document. Be mindful of the target’s security and accessibility, as this method has fewer internal controls.
Can I create dynamic links to documents based on user roles?
Yes, advanced techniques can create dynamic links, allowing you to control document access based on user permissions within your Joomla site. This requires some code modification and careful planning.
What are the best practices for linking to PDFs?
Employ the standard hyperlink format; ensure the correct file path is used. Consider adding descriptive file names for better user experience.
How do I ensure the document link remains functional if the document’s location changes?
Utilize absolute paths for linking to documents; this ensures the link remains accurate regardless of changes to website structure. Using relative paths for internal documents within a controlled environment is acceptable.